Former Pussy Riot member admits cooperating with FSB
A former member of protest group Pussy Riot, Rita Flores, has said she has cooperated with Russia's Federal Security Service since 2023. She reportedly helped gather information on artists and political activists, including former bandmates.

Rita Flores, a former member of the Russian protest art group Pussy Riot, has publicly stated that she has been cooperating with Russia's Federal Security Service (FSB) since 2023.
According to her own statement, she assisted the security agency in collecting information about various artists and political activists. Among those named as subjects of this information-gathering are other members of Pussy Riot.
Pussy Riot has become widely known as one of the most prominent groups critical of Russian authorities, with its members repeatedly facing state repression over their political activism. The revelation that a former member cooperated with the FSB offers a new perspective on the possible involvement of Russian security services in monitoring opposition figures and artists.
